What is an Angel Shot?

The angel shot is a simple yet powerful cocktail that serves a dual purpose: it’s a delicious drink and a safety signal. Typically ordered by someone who feels uncomfortable or threatened, the angel shot alerts bartenders to provide assistance discreetly. It’s a brilliant way to create a safe environment without drawing attention to oneself.

How Do Bartenders Interpret the Angel Shot Order?

Bartenders are trained to recognize the angel shot order and respond accordingly. If a customer orders an angel shot, it can mean different things based on the specific instructions given:

  • Angel Shot Neat: The customer feels uncomfortable and needs an escort to their car.
  • Angel Shot On the Rocks: The customer requires help from the staff to remove an unwanted person.
  • Angel Shot with a Twist: This can indicate a more urgent situation, calling for immediate intervention.

How Can Bars Promote the Angel Shot?

Bars can promote the angel shot by:

  • Including it in their drink menu with an explanation.
  • Training staff on how to respond appropriately.
  • Displaying signage in restrooms or at the bar about the angel shot's purpose.

By making the angel shot a visible part of their service, bars can ensure that patrons feel safe and supported.
